TinyLogic UHS Dual Buffer with Schmitt Trigger Inputs NC7WZ17 Description The NC7WZ17 is a dual buffer with Schmitt trigger inputs from onsemi’s Ultra−High Speed (UHS) series of TinyLogic products. The device is fabricated with advanced CMOS technology to achieve ultra−high speed with high output drive, while maintaining low static power dissipation over a very broad VCC operating range. The device is specified to operate over the 1.65 V to 5.5 V VCC range. The inputs and outputs are high−impedance when VCC is 0 V. Inputs tolerate voltages up to 5.5 V, independent of VCC operating voltage.
